    What's special

    We are now showing by private appointments. We are proud to present 66 South 4th Street. This turnkey 4 story,double duplex, Williamsburg two family, at approximately 3600 sq feet. This property offers the possibility of being utilized as a great work/live space. Located in Williamsburg, one of the hottest markets in the world, it is also located in a qualified Opportunity Zone. The gorgeous 20 X 43 manicured garden, 20 X 37 artist studio with a private balcony; 4 floors, plus an unfinished basement, truly makes this property unique! This one of a kind property sitting on a 20 ft x 90 foot lot. 66 South 4th St is an exceptional find in a desired location, only a block away from Domino Park, the newly built 6-acre waterfront park. Only a short walk to the ferry, you'll be in Manhattan in no time. Not only is this property located in a QUALIFIED OPPORTUNITY ZONE; it is close to shopping, bars and restaurants. You are truly in the heart of it all. Step out of your garden floor duplex kitchen into your stunningly paved garden, complete with a koi pond. The garden is truly an intimate place where you can spend hours in complete tranquility, while the city rustles and bustles unbeknownst to you. Enjoy a home cooked meal in your separate dining room or host guests in your family room. The whole garden duplex is fitted with architectural sound resistant windows. Walk barefoot along the slate floor in your kitchen and hallway to a private staircase leading to the second floor. On the second floor you will find an office, a master bedroom and bathroom that would make Coco Chanel blush. The 1st floor of the second duplex is currently set up as a remodeled 1 bedroom, 1 bath with a spacious office containing a loft. There are hardwood floors throughout the apartment. If you need some creative inspiration you could just sit on your 4th floor balcony and take in the views of the Williamsburg Bridge. Then head back inside to your artist studio with a full bath. This property could be used as one of those single FAMILY homes you'll see in Architectural Digest, or left as an income producing two family. Possibly even convert the property into a three or four family, thanks to the property's M1-2/R6/MX-8 zoning. There just really isn't another property like this anywhere.
